A spin bike is an indoor bike that is designed to duplicate the feeling of regular road cycling. A typical spin bike has a very heavy flywheel. A friction pad or other brake provides damping that mirrors the drag and other resistive forces that a road cyclist experiences; the inertia of the wheel simulates the way a regular bike keeps moving even after you stop pedaling. A spin bike has a flywheel in two parts—a 12.5 kg disk with radius 0.23 m, and a 7.0 kg ring with mass concentrated at the outer edge of the disk. A friction pad exerts a force of 9.7 N on the outside of the disk. A cyclist is pedaling, spinning the disk at a typical 180 rpm. If she stops pedaling, how long will it take for the flywheel to come to a stop?
